Small-cap stocks rebound in April with best month in a decade
India's small-cap stocks experienced their strongest monthly rally in at least a decade during April, recovering significantly after a sharp March sell-off. Local investors actively bought beaten-down stocks, with the Nifty Smallcap 250 index jumping 17.1%. This surge followed a period where many small-cap stocks had declined, attracting interest in quality businesses with strong growth prospects.
